Ingredients for Energy Balls with hemp seeds
- 125 g sunflower seeds
- 130 g dried dates
- 2 tablespoons cocoa powder (low in oil)
- 1 tablespoon coconut oil
- 2 tbsp hemp seeds
- ½ tsp cinnamon
- 1 pinch cardamom
- 1 pinch of sea salt
Preparation of the Energy Balls with hemp seeds
Step 1
Put 125 g sunflower seeds with 2 tbsp hemp seeds in a blender and grind everything briefly to a fine flour.
Step 2
Soak the dried dates in hot water for 10 minutes.
Step 3
Add the soaked dates, 2 tablespoons of cacao powder, 1 tablespoon of coconut oil, ½ teaspoon of cinnamon, 1 pinch of cardamom, and 1 pinch of sea salt to the ground mixture in the blender and blend on high until smooth.
Step 4
Form small bite-sized balls with your hands (yields about 15-20 pieces, depending on size).
Tip:
You can coat the balls in toasted sesame seeds, coconut flakes, dried raspberries or finely chopped nuts. This healthy power snack is also a nice gift, because homemade makes much more joy than purchased gifts. Store the balls in the refrigerator. There they can be kept for up to 10 days. They are also great for freezing and defrost very quickly. So you can prepare them ahead for enjoying at a later time.
